“Discover Spanish” online software announced by Blount County Public Library
MARYVILLE, TN ( September 1, 2009) ¿Hablas español? You can learn to speak Spanish, the second most important business language in the world after English, with “Discover Spanish” online from your home, office or the library. Spanish is spoken by more than 350 million people and is the official language in 21 countries.

As part of this year’s participation in The Big Read, a community-wide effort to emphasize the importance of reading and literacy, the Blount County Public Library is announcing the availability of a new free conversational Spanish language software.

“Discover Spanish” was purchased by the library as a resource for people wanting an easy, fun and rewarding beginner-level introduction to the Spanish language. Simple to navigate and with remote access, the software encourages patrons to use “Discover Spanish” anywhere, any time—at any internet computer or by checking out a CD using a library card.

Kathy Pagles, library director, says that there is a definite desire among many Blount County residents to learn more about our Spanish-speaking community and get to know them personally. “One way to learn about another culture is to learn its language. ‘Discover Spanish’ is a fun and easy way to learn and practice some basics of Spanish,” says Pagles.

Registration: “Discover Spanish” is an effective online learning system featuring 36 interactive lessons available at any internet computer through the Blount County Public Library website at www.blountlibrary.org. For this hands-on learning experience, Johnny Spanish is a cartoon-like host for Discover Spanish who guides the user through the various interactive lessons. At the conclusion of each lesson, the software provides a recapping “test” that reviews the lesson and tests the user’s facility in applying the lesson.

Because the learning system is actually fun and lessons are short, learners can “play” as long as they want. The software retains the user’s scores and lesson level for a return any time to continue the lessons. Discover Spanish is unique in that it offers the value of play which increases retention. It is appealing to all ages, from 9-99.

Accompanying podcasts make “Discover Spanish” accessible for “learning on the go.”

To access “Discover Spanish” lessons, go to the library website at www.blountlibrary.org, click on “Electronic Resources” and then click on the “Discover Spanish” icon. The program requires registration, and anyone having a Blount County library card can register for free by entering the library card number. Key Points: “Discover Spanish” utilizes a combination immersion and grammar-based approach, along with a “building block” layering of lessons based upon the latest research in language acquisition. The lessons have these key points:

“The program was developed by language experts and supports the “5 Cs” of the National Standards for Foreign Language Learning (Communication, Cultures, Connections, Comparisons, and Communities).
“The 36 innovative lessons combine state-of-the-art technology with proven language acquisition techniques to provide an engaging and effective learning experience.
“Upon completion of the course, students will be able to understand native speakers and communicate effectively in everyday situations.
“Discover Spanish podcasts allow patrons to learn on the go. Students can practice words and phrases from each lesson while in the car, at the gym, or wherever they take their Ipods or MP3 players.
“Discover Spanish is a valuable tool for homeschoolers. It tracks the progress of multiple users.”
CDROMs – Patrons can check out from the library three “Discover Spanish” CDs in addition to the online services.
Features: Using a language immersion approach, the 36 lessons are organized into thematic units, all based upon cutting-edge learning methodology. The English translations are fun and require interactive learning with animated characters as well as challenging, educational games. The explanations of language structure and grammar rules are simple and easy to understand. Each lesson integrates Hispanic culture into the lesson. Accompanying lessons are available on IPod and MP3.

Why Spanish? Nearly 40 million Hispanics now live in the United States, representing 13.7% of the population. For those who work in the public sector (e.g., schools, medical offices, postal services, retail businesses), the need for being able to communicate in the Spanish language is growing. In addition, millions of Americans travel to Spain and Latin America each year, and learning at least a little of the language before they go increases the interest and enjoyment.
